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lockwood to Argyle Street start from as little as £24.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lockwood to Argyle Street start from £69.90 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lockwood to Argyle Street are available for £79.20 one way

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Lockwood Train Station

While Lockwood Train Station may not be the grandest of transport hubs, it does offer essential amenities for a comfortable and accessible travel experience. The station does not have a staffed ticket office, but fret not as ticket machines are available to help you purchase and collect tickets with ease. Smartcards are not issued here, yet it's easy to collect pre-booked tickets from the accessible machines on site. Moreover, accessibility is a key focus at Lockwood, with step-free access across the station and help points available for assistance. The station operates as a Category A site, ensuring smooth navigation for scooter users and those with limited mobility. However, it lacks physical amenities like toilets, waiting rooms, or seating areas, so plan accordingly.

Facilities and Amenities

At Argyle Street station, purchasing and collecting tickets is hassle-free with a wide range of options available. The ticket office is accessible from 06:30 to 23:15 on weekdays and Saturdays but closes earlier on Sundays, operating from 10:10 to 17:40. If you've bought tickets online, you can collect them conveniently from on-site ticket machines, which are also accessible to all travelers. Although there isn't a dedicated smartcard issuance at the station, validators for them are present, integrating modern travel conveniences with traditional services.

For those in need of help and support, the station is equipped with departure screens, regular announcements, customer help points, and a dedicated email for ScotRail customer queries. CCTV cameras help ensure your safety at the station. While the station provides no luggage storage facilities, lost property services operate from 7 AM to 9 PM daily. There’s no specific area for accessible toilets, and no car parking is currently available, so it’s best to plan ahead if you’re driving.
